What is Java Compiler?

A Java compiler is a compiler that converts Java code to bytecode, that is .java file to .class file. An online java compiler is an online tool that can be used to compile and run java programs.

Here is the list of 10 Best Online Java Compilers.

1. Codiva

  • It can be run on mobile also, parses the compilation errors and shows it in the editor. 
  • By the time you complete typing, you get the compilation results.

2. JDoodle 

  • Along with Java, it supports more than 72 Programming Languages.
  • It supports almost all the latest versions of JDK.
  • It also has an option for Dark Theme to make it more developer-friendly.

3. CodeChef (well known competitive programming community)

  • Users can open, edit and download their source files too.
  • Users can provide custom input and run java programs.
  • It also provides information regarding memory and time consumed after compilation.

4. Browxy

  • easy to use and supports other programming languages such as PHP, C, C++, C#, Python, etc.

5. JavaOnlineCompiler

  • It has a simple editor window to copy/paste code.
  • We can change the theme as per our choice.
  • It has a simple and minimal design.

6. Paiza.io

  • public or private sharing via the network
  • collaboration with the group of users
  • fast autocomplete

7. Rextester

  • It has one of the best live collaboration support. Just share the URL, start typing.
  • Multiple users can edit at the same time.

8. OnlineGDB

  • It supports only Java 8.
  • If you write some complex program, and have to debug in case of an error, the debugger will come in handy.

9. OneCompiler

  • It’s one of the robust, feature-rich online compilers for Java language, running the latest Java LTS version which is Java 11.

10. InterviewBitJavaCompiler

  • supports the latest versions of Java and programmers can write, run, debug and share code snippets seamlessly.
